越来越受到开发者和用户的关注,答允开发者通过编程调用接口来生成以太坊钱包,im官网,使用公共的API处事时要谨慎。
我们将深入探讨这一主题,并打印出生成的钱包地址和私钥。
以上就是关于如何通过API创建以太坊钱包的全面指导,为了防止丢失私钥,API方式可以提高效率并减少人为错误,如Infura、Alchemy或个人节点处事,而且返回的数据格式也相对简单,安详性是一个至关重要的考虑因素,钱包中的以太坊会丢失吗? 是的,接着,例如,注册并创建账号,通过Web3.js库可以使用`web3.eth.getBalance(walletAddress)`方法查询某个地址的余额, account.privateKey);return account;}createWallet(); 此代码片段中,例如使用安详的物理方式(如纸质备份)来生存私钥或助记词。
当凌驾免费的配额后。
返回的余额是以wei为单位。
开发者不只可以创造新的以太坊地址, 调用API: 使用API密钥调用创建钱包的接口,而通过API(应用措施接口)创建以太坊钱包,别的,以下是一些常见的安详办法: 离线存储私钥: 制止在网络上存储私钥, ,这种调用也十分容易实现,imToken,通过API。
用户可能需要按需付费, account.address);console.log('私钥:',不外,期盼各人都能在以太坊这一平台上探索出更多的可能性,但会有一些限制(如请求次数、存储容量等),还可以打点钱包的安详性、余额查询和交易发送等功能,钱包是用于存储和打点以太币及各种基于以太坊的代币的重要工具,因为这些代币都是以太坊尺度的一部门,在本篇文章中。
选择编程语言: 按照项目需求选择合适的编程语言(如JavaScript、Python等),要创建以太坊钱包,使用`web3.eth.accounts.create()`方法创建一个新的钱包,转账和交易上链仍然需要支付以太坊网络的gas费用。
与传统手动创建钱包的方式差异,因为它们不直接连接互联网。
API创建以太坊钱包的示例代码 下面是一个使用JavaScript和Web3.js库通过API创建以太坊钱包的示例代码: const Web3 = require('web3');const web3 = new Web3('https://your-infura-or-alchemy-url');async function createWallet() {const account = web3.eth.accounts.create();console.log('地址:',建议用户采纳有效的备份办法,希望能够帮手开发者更好地理解这一过程并有效操作相关技术,这是使用以太坊钱包的一个重要风险, 使用硬件钱包: 硬件钱包可以提供更高的安详性, API创建以太坊钱包的基本概念 API创建以太坊钱包是一种自动化流程,在以太坊中。
能够为开发者提供更便捷的方式来实现钱包功能,确保私钥的安详存储都是防止资产损失的关键,而是将其生存在安详的离线设备上, 5. 如何检察以太坊钱包的余额? 检察以太坊钱包余额通常需要通过API接口调用, 3. 使用API创建的以太坊钱包是否安详吗? 通过API创建的以太坊钱包的安详性和接纳的安详办法密切相关, 2. 如果丢失了私钥,无论是通过API创建还是手动创建。
许多API处事提供商(如Infura和Alchemy)提供免费套餐,由于涉及互联网通信, 随着区块链技术的成长。
用户应该对此有充实认识。
尽量制止将敏感数据袒露在API请求中, 获取API密钥: 在用户控制面板中生成API密钥,开发者需要选择一个支持以太坊的API处事提供商,我们首先导入Web3库并连接到以太坊网络,以便在后续请求中使用, API创建以太坊钱包的步调 首先,包罗如何通过API创建以太坊钱包、相关技术、以及常见问题解析。
按期更新安详办法: 不绝提升安详技术常识,如果钱包的私钥丢失,以太坊作为一种主流的智能合约平台,用户将无法访问与之关联的以太坊或任何代币,。
如果开发者能够妥善处理惩罚私钥并接纳适当的掩护办法,每个处事提供商的API调用方法可能差异,但主要步调通常包罗: 注册账号: 访问处事提供商的网站, 4. API创建以太坊钱包是否支持其他代币? 通过API创建的以太坊钱包通常支持以太坊网络上的任何ERC-20或ERC-721代币,开发者可以通过钱包地址接收和存储这些代币。
常见问题解答1. API创建以太坊钱包需要费用吗? 使用API创建以太坊钱包的费用问题取决于所选处事提供商,在大大都API处事中,那么就可以确保钱包的安详,但在进行转账操纵时务须要遵循各代币的尺度API调用方法,并处理惩罚返回的数据,这与API处事无关,并按照最新的安详动态更新掩护办法, 如何包管以太坊钱包的安详性 创建以太坊钱包时,开发者可以将其转换为以太(ETH)进行展示,区块链的未来归根结底在于如何提升安详性、降低门槛、提升技术应用广度。